MEASUREMENT OF ACOUSTOELASTIC AND THIRD-ORDER ELASTIC CONSTANTS FOR RAIL STEEL
Measurements of the stress-induced changes in ultrasonic wave speeds in steels typically used in railroad rails are presented. All of the five possible relative changes in wave speeds for a unaxial state of stress have been determined and agree, to within the limits of accuracy of the measurement, with the second-order theory of Hughes and Kelly. The third-order elastic constants are calculated from the acoustoelastic data.
